State of Power Generation Companies in India (2026)
The power generation sector in India has reached an installed capacity exceeding 450 GW in 2026, characterized by a rapid diversification of the energy mix. While coal-fired plants managed by behemoths like National Thermal Power Corporation (NTPC) and various state-run entities like MAHAGENCO in Maharashtra or TANGEDCO in Tamil Nadu still provide baseline stability, renewable energy developers are capturing the lion's share of new capital expenditure. Major private conglomerates such as Adani Green Energy, Tata Power, ReNew Share, and JSW Energy are aggressively commissioning massive ultra-mega solar parks in Rajasthan's Thar Desert and wind farms across the coastal stretches of Gujarat and Andhra Pradesh.
This growth is heavily steered by state-level policies and national mandates like the Green Energy Open Access Rules, which allow commercial and industrial consumers to purchase power directly from green generators. Furthermore, the PM-KUSUM scheme has decentralized solar generation across rural landscapes, creating thousands of localized, small-scale power generation companies that operate independently of the main transmission lines. In urban industrial corridors like the NCR (National Capital Region), Pune, and Chennai, captive power plants run by manufacturing giants are also registering as independent generating units to trade surplus power on the Indian Energy Exchange (IEX).
From a technological standpoint, the 2026 market is prioritizing grid-scale Battery Energy Storage Systems (BESS) and Pumped Storage Projects (PSP). Companies like NHPC Limited and SJVN are pivoting their portfolios to include these hydro-storage assets to balance the intermittent nature of solar and wind power.
